It’s very easy to transfer at ATL especially domestic to International. Your bags should indeed be checked all the way to LHR. There’s no security check points going domestic to International at ATL either. Get off the DL flight then head to the plane train which is on the lower level, just follow the signs to the International terminal and head down the escalators to the plane train platform. The plane train runs every few minutes and stops at every terminal. Once in the international terminal, head up the escalators which brings you out still airside just passed security. You will be absolutely fine with that connection time, even time to visit the Delta Sky Club which is on the upper level (if there’s no queue to get in).

My record time doing a transfer this way at ATL is 15mins (gate to gate).
